Order-two essential-weight conjecture for extremal matrices

Let AA be an extremal multidimensional matrix of order 22, and let KK be a vertex of the polyhedron of polyplexes in AA. Write supp(K)\operatorname{supp}(K) for the support of KK, and let kαk_{\alpha} be the corresponding values for αsupp(K)\alpha\in\operatorname{supp}(K).

Order-two essential-weight conjecture. The values kαk_{\alpha}, for αsupp(K)\alpha\in\operatorname{supp}(K), are essential weights of an optimal hyperplane cover for some multidimensional extremal matrix of order 22.

The conjecture is intended to provide another description of optimal hyperplane covers for extremal matrices of order 22. The source supplies no proof or resolution.
